Work History

Software Development Lead

UCLA Engineering
12.2020 - Current
  • Development lead for all in-house and on-contract software deliverables at the research institute, includes managing developers
  • Responsibilities included collaborating with researchers to brainstorm research opportunities, specify design requirements, negotiate constraints and implement scalable, production-ready solutions
  • PG&E – Collaborated with PG&E to create a fire propagation risk modeling tool to asses fire risk levels throughout California
  • Led the software team to successfully complete and deliver $5million dollar software specifications
  • (https://apps.risksciences.ucla.edu/fire-risk/)
  • NASA – In collaboration with JPL, Maintained and developed the HYBRID CASUAL LOGIC app which is used for probabilistic risk assessment
  • Implemented many new tools using React, and Django for backend
  • (https://apps.risksciences.ucla.edu/hcl/)
  • J-NRA – Collaborated with Japanese Nuclear Regulation Authority to lead the development of Phoenix, a webapp used for Human reliability analysis
  • Successfully delivered and renewed contract for further development
  • (https://apps.risksciences.ucla.edu/phoenix/)
